Legal Counsel in Australia median base salary $114,285/yr.
Information is based on 14 Legal Counsel jobs advertised between May 2023 and May 2024.
How much do Legal Counsel earn in Australia? The average salary of Legal Counsel is $114,285 in Australia
$114,285 /yr
Last updated May 10 2024
The average pay range for Legal Counsel is between $114K and $114K.
Salaries vary from a low of $80K up to $140K per year.
The average number of Legal Counsel roles advertised per month is 47 in Australia
between May 2023 and May 2024.

How many years does it take to become a Legal Counsel?
Most candidates undertake an average of 3 years Legal Services prior to being appointed as a Legal Counsel.
Average Legal Services required to become a Legal Counsel
Last updated May 11 2024
Most candidates have on average 7 years working experience prior to becoming a Legal Counsel.
